Seared Salmon Fillet with Garlic Green Beans and Brown Rice
Enjoy a beautifully seared salmon fillet paired with crisp garlic green beans and a modest serving of nutty brown rice. This vibrant dish delivers a satisfying balance of lean protein and wholesome sides, perfect for a nourishing dinner that delights the senses with its garlicky aroma and tender, flaky salmon.
INGREDIENTS
8 oz Salmon Fillet
1/4 cup cooked Brown Rice
1 cup Green Beans
1/2 teaspo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il
1 Garlic Clove
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on fillet dry with a paper towel and season lightly with salt and pepper.
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Add the salmon fillet skin-side down and sear for about 4-5 minutes until the skin is crispy.
Flip the salmon and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until the fish is just cooked through.
Meanwhile, bring a pot of water to boil and blanch the green beans for 2-3 minutes until they are tender yet crisp. Drain and set aside.
In a small pan, warm the olive oil over medium heat and sauté the minced garlic (from one clove) for about 30 seconds until fragrant, then toss in the green beans to coat evenly.
Prepare the brown rice according to package instructions if not already done. Use a measured 1/4 cup serving.
Plate the seared salmon fillet alongside the garlic green beans and a serving of brown rice. Serve immediately and enjoy.
